AbstractThe quantum Boltzmann equation (QBE), derived in previous papers, is extended to systems with strong interparticle interactions. In particular, the non‐diagonal hierarchy of kinetic equations for [ℒ︁hin]N ccζ, N = 0, 1,…, ∞, where ℒ︁in is the interaction Liouvillian, is solved by iteration in order to obtain a generalized non‐diagonal QBE. The application to the 2D quantum Hall effect, integral and fractional, is discussed.
